What is the difference between IAM and IGA in employee onboarding?

IAM handles the mechanics of giving the right person the right access at the right time. IGA adds governance, including access policy definition, review cycles, and audit evidence. In onboarding, IAM provisions accounts and entitlements, while IGA ensures those decisions stay compliant, traceable, and aligned to role changes over time.

Why This Matters for Security Teams

Employee onboarding is where identity governance either becomes repeatable or becomes a manual exception process. IAM is responsible for account creation, directory updates, and initial access assignment. IGA adds the control layer that verifies those assignments against policy, role definitions, and evidence requirements. If the two are blurred, onboarding can become fast but noncompliant, or compliant on paper but slow in practice.

That distinction matters because onboarding decisions often set the baseline for downstream access reviews, joiner-mover-leaver workflows, and audit readiness. In environments with many applications, entitlements, and exceptions, teams may provision access correctly once and still fail governance later if no one reviews whether the access still matches the employee’s function. NIST guidance on access control and accountability, including NIST SP 800-53 Rev 5 Security and Privacy Controls, reinforces that provisioning alone is not the same as control assurance. In practice, many security teams discover the difference between IAM and IGA only after onboarding has already created excess access, not through a designed governance process.

How It Works in Practice

In onboarding, IAM handles the operational path from request to access. That usually includes creating the user record, joining the employee to the correct directory groups, assigning baseline entitlements, and activating needed applications. IGA sits above that workflow and determines whether those access decisions are allowed, who approved them, how they map to a role, and whether the result can be evidenced later.

A practical model is to treat IAM as execution and IGA as decision oversight. HR or a source-of-truth system triggers the joiner event. IAM provisions the account, but only after IGA validates policy rules such as department, location, employment type, manager approval, and segregation-of-duties checks. IGA then stores the approval trail and can later drive access certifications, recertification reminders, and exception tracking. For onboarding that means the first access grant is not just fast, but also traceable.

This is where the two systems complement each other:

  • IAM creates identities, assigns credentials, and connects users to applications.
  • IGA checks whether those assignments match role policy and compliance requirements.
  • IAM makes access happen at onboarding time.
  • IGA makes sure the access remains defensible after onboarding.

For practitioners, the key control question is whether onboarding entitlements are derived from role logic or assembled case by case. Role-based onboarding works best when job functions are stable and applications are well catalogued. Where role definitions are fuzzy, current guidance suggests using policy-backed approval flows and continuous review rather than assuming the initial grant will remain correct. This guidance tends to break down in highly matrixed organisations with frequent role exceptions and many application owners, because manual approvals and review trails quickly become inconsistent.

Common Variations and Edge Cases

Tighter governance often increases onboarding friction, so organisations have to balance speed against control assurance. That tradeoff is most visible when business leaders want immediate access on day one, but compliance teams require role validation, segregation checks, or manager sign-off first.

Not every organisation separates IAM and IGA cleanly. In smaller environments, one platform may handle both provisioning and governance workflows. In mature programmes, IAM may be integrated with HR and SSO tooling, while IGA manages policy models, attestation, and audit evidence. The important point is functional separation, not tool separation.

There is also no universal standard for how granular onboarding roles should be. Best practice is evolving. Some organisations rely on coarse job codes, while others map access to fine-grained birthright roles plus application-specific exceptions. The more dynamic the workforce, the more important it is to revisit those mappings after onboarding, not just at the point of hire. Where onboarding touches privileged systems or sensitive workflows, the risk profile is higher and the review cycle should be shorter. For broader identity assurance context, NIST controls and identity governance practices are usually paired with lifecycle evidence, not treated as one-off provisioning tasks.

In practice, the cleanest onboarding programs are the ones where IAM can provision quickly, but IGA can still prove that every access grant had a policy basis and a reviewable approval path.
